SGX launches iEdge Singapore Next 50 Indices to track emerging stocks

Available in market-cap weighted and liquidity weighted formats.

SGX Indices has introduced the iEdge Singapore Next 50 Indices, a new benchmark tracking the next tier of large and liquid companies outside the Straits Times Index (STI).

The indices use a rules-based approach based on free-float, market capitalisation and liquidity, and come in two versions: market-cap weighted and liquidity weighted.

They highlight the performance of the next 50 mainboard companies below the STI’s top 30, giving investors exposure to rising mid-cap stocks.

From January to August this year, institutional investors net purchased $425m in small- and mid-cap stocks, whilst daily turnover surged 50% year-on-year to $163m, driven largely by retail investors.

SGX expects this positive momentum to fuel demand for new market-tracking tools that capture evolving investment opportunities.

The new indices add to SGX’s growing suite of market and thematic benchmarks, supporting investor demand for tools that capture Singapore’s expanding stock market opportunities.
